Mumbai, June 27 -- Alstom's joint venture with Indian Railways, Madhepura Electric Locomotive Private Limited, has secured a new five-year maintenance services contract valued at €107 million. The agreement covers comprehensive maintenance of 250 WAG-12B electric locomotives at the MELPL Nagpur Depot.

The contract follows the successful completion of the previous four-year agreement and reflects Indian Railways' continued confidence in Alstom's maintenance capabilities. The Nagpur depot has emerged as an important centre for locomotive maintenance and operational support within India's rail network.

The 12,000 HP Prima T8 WAG-12B locomotives play a key role in India's freight movement and green mobility goals. Capable of hauling 6,000-tonne loads at speeds of up to 120 kph, the locomotives are deployed on Dedicated Freight Corridors to increase freight capacity and reduce emissions.

Under the agreement, MELPL will maintain both the 250 locomotives and depot infrastructure. Alstom will continue deploying specialised Prompt Response Teams with tools and spares at strategic locations across the country to improve issue resolution and maximise fleet availability. The contract also supports ongoing skill development through training programmes at the depot."
